hmac

    0

    1答えて

    私は最近、他のイントラネットWebアプリケーション用のエンドポイントをいくつか開いて、Oracleデータベースの表スペース内の一部のデータを選択するWebAPIプロジェクトを作成しています。私の最大の関心事の1つは、現在、私のAPIへの無効な呼び出しに対するWebAPIの保護です。 私は、私のAPIを呼び出すことができる別の許可されたWebアプリケーションで固有のキーを共有するHMACのアプローチ

    3

    1答えて

    OpenSSL::HMAC documentationを参照してください。 require "openssl" puts OpenSSL::HMAC.hexdigest(:sha256, "secret key", "data") を、私はこのエラーを取得しています: 私はこれをしようとしています undefined constant OpenSSL::HMAC その他のOpenSSL方法

    -1

    1答えて

    私は鍵のパラメータをopenssl dgstに渡そうとしていません。私はGDAX取引プラットフォームへのインターフェースを試みており、各リクエストはHMACによって署名されていなければなりません。彼らは明らかに「HMACのためのキーとしてそれを使用する前に、最初のbase64でデコード(64 バイトになる)英数字の秘密の文字列。」 に言います この結果、64バイトのバイナリ文字列になります。しかし

    0

    1答えて

    をコードしていました。 var signature = crypto.createHmac("sha256", key).update(body).digest("base64"); どのようにLUAを使用して同じ署名を作成できますか。私はそれがHMAC、SHA256およびbase64でプリミティブを持っていますが、私はLUA として、このコードを実装することができますかどうかはわかりません見

    1

    1答えて

    私は、V4 HMAC署名を生成する方法についてAWSの例を追ってきました。私はこれをJavaで成功させましたが、Node/JavaScriptで動作させようとしています。私のコードを使用すると、下の1番目の例で正しい中間鍵が生成されますが、次の例では、StringToSignという正しい中間鍵を生成した同じコードが仮定された正しい署名を生成できません。 正しい仲介キー: secretkey = '

    2

    1答えて

    ローカルでテストするwebhookリクエストを作成しようとしましたが、ライブラリ がエラーを起こしました。リクエストを送信してリクエストの本文を生成しました balance.available webhookここ: https://dashboard.stripe.com/test/webhooks/we_1BI2E2IYOmXNPhc1uOyyRvHg 私は本文をコピーして/tmp/stripe

    0

    1答えて

    現時点では、Amazon MWSのHMACの生成に少し苦労しています。 私はそれがどのように動作するのか理解していると思いました。 私はScratchpadでリクエストを生成しました。 ScratchpadはSHA 256 HMACとBase64 HMACに署名する文字列を表示します。 署名する文字列は、docuで説明されているように4行から構成されます。 HMACのためのいくつかのOnlinec

    0

    1答えて

    私はAndroidでHMAC-SHA256をやっています。ここでは、次のコードは、次のとおりです。 String baseString = "e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9.eyJpc3MiOiI2NjU0MjA5MGE2NGJhYWU0MzI4NGFiYTY0MmNkNWJmNmFlNzdkNjFhIiwiYXVkIjoiaHR0cHM6Ly9hcHAu

    1

    1答えて

    暗号化されたCryptoJS暗号化された文字列は、Pythonで異なるパラメータを渡すことができますか? 2番目のCryptoJS実装をPythonで実装する方法 、clientKey2を取得する方法、これは最初の結果しか得られません。ありがとうございます! > saltedPassword=CryptoJS.PBKDF2("key", "salt", {keySize: 8,iterations

    0

    1答えて

    これは私のコードです: function verifyRequest($request, $secret) { // Per the Shopify docs: // Everything except hmac and signature... $hmac = $request['hmac']; unset($request['hmac']);